What Features Make a Grinder Effective for Collecting Kief?

Several key features contribute to the effectiveness of a grinder for collecting kief:

  • Multi-Chamber Design: A multi-chamber grinder typically consists of at least three compartments: one for grinding, one for collecting kief, and sometimes an additional chamber for storing the ground material. This design allows for the separation of kief from the ground herb, making it easier to collect and use.
  • Mesh Screen: The presence of a fine mesh screen in the kief collection chamber allows for the sifting of kief from the ground material. This screen helps to filter out larger particles while allowing the fine, powdery kief to pass through, ensuring a more potent collection.
  • Sharp, Durable Blades: High-quality grinders feature sharp and durable blades that can effectively break down the herb into a fine consistency. The better the grind, the more trichomes are released, which increases the amount of kief collected during the process.
  • Material Quality: Grinders made from materials such as aluminum or stainless steel tend to be more durable and provide a better grinding experience. These materials are less prone to wear and tear, ensuring that the grinder stays effective for a longer period, leading to consistent kief collection.
  • Magnetic Lid: A magnetic lid can enhance the grinding experience by keeping the grinder securely closed during use, preventing spills and ensuring that all ground material and kief remain inside. This feature is particularly beneficial when grinding sticky strains, as it minimizes mess and maximizes collection.
  • Size and Portability: The size of the grinder can also affect its kief collecting capability; larger grinders may allow for more herb to be ground at once, leading to increased kief production. However, compact and portable designs can be more convenient for on-the-go use, allowing users to enjoy efficient grinding and kief collection wherever they are.

How Does Chamber Design Affect Kief Collection?

Chamber design plays a crucial role in the efficiency of kief collection in grinders.

  • Multi-Chamber Grinders: These grinders typically consist of multiple compartments, allowing for the separation of ground herb and kief. The design includes a fine mesh screen that filters out the trichomes, enabling users to collect kief more effectively as it falls through to the bottom chamber.
  • Sifting Screens: Grinders that incorporate sifting screens help to catch and collect kief by using various mesh sizes. A finer mesh will filter out smaller particles, ensuring that only the most potent trichomes are collected, which enhances the quality of the kief retrieved.
  • Shape and Size of the Chamber: The shape and size of the grinding chamber can influence how well the herb is ground and how easily kief is collected. A larger chamber allows for more space for the herb to move around, which can lead to better grinding action and increased kief production.
  • Material of the Grinder: The material used in the grinder affects how well it grinds and retains kief. Metal grinders tend to provide a smoother grinding experience compared to plastic ones, which can result in a better yield of kief due to less static cling and more efficient grinding.
  • Teeth Design: The design and sharpness of the grinder’s teeth also impact kief collection. Sharp, well-placed teeth create a more efficient grinding action, leading to a finer grind that can produce more kief as trichomes are broken off during the process.

How Can I Maximize Kief Collection When Using a Grinder?

To maximize kief collection when using a grinder, consider the following factors:

  • Three-Chamber Grinders: These grinders typically have compartments for grinding, collecting kief, and storing your product. The middle chamber grinds the material while the bottom chamber collects the kief that falls through a fine mesh screen, allowing for efficient separation and maximization of your kief yield.
  • Mesh Screen Quality: The quality of the mesh screen in your grinder is crucial for kief collection. A finer mesh allows only the smallest particles to pass through, ensuring that you collect more potent kief while keeping larger plant material in the grinding chamber.
  • Material of the Grinder: The material of the grinder can affect the collection of kief. Aluminum grinders tend to produce finer kief due to their durability and sharp teeth, which help break down the material more effectively compared to plastic grinders that may not grind as finely.
  • Regular Maintenance: Keeping your grinder clean and free from resin buildup is essential for optimal kief collection. Regularly disassembling the grinder and cleaning the chambers and screen can help maintain airflow and ensure that kief can easily fall through into the collection chamber.
  • Proper Grinding Technique: The way you grind can significantly impact kief collection. Avoid overpacking the grinder, as this can lead to uneven grinding; instead, use smaller amounts of material and grind gently to allow kief to separate more effectively.
  • Storing Kief Properly: After collecting kief, store it in a cool, dark place in an airtight container to preserve its potency. Kief can degrade when exposed to light and air, so taking care of your collected kief ensures you maintain its quality for later use.

What Maintenance Tips Ensure Optimal Kief Collection from My Grinder?

To ensure optimal kief collection from your grinder, consider the following ma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Keeping your grinder clean is essential for effective kief collection. Residue buildup can clog the screen and reduce the amount of kief collected, so it’s advisable to clean your grinder every few weeks using a brush or isopropyl alcohol.
  • Use a Grinder with a Kief Catcher: Choosing a grinder specifically designed with a kief catcher at the bottom can significantly enhance kief collection. These grinders often feature a fine mesh screen that separates the kief from the plant material, allowing for more efficient collection.
  • Grind Consistently: Grinding your cannabis consistently ensures that the plant material is broken down evenly, which helps in maximizing kief production. A uniform grind allows the trichomes to detach more effectively, leading to higher kief yields.
  • Store Your Grinder Properly: Proper storage of your grinder can prevent moisture and contaminants from affecting the collected kief. Storing it in a cool, dry place ensures that the kief remains potent and does not clump together due to humidity.
  • Use Dry Cannabis: Using dry cannabis for grinding can enhance kief collection as moisture can cause the trichomes to stick to the plant material instead of falling through the screen. Ensuring your cannabis is adequately cured and dried will yield more kief during the grinding process.
